MADISON, N.J. - The Drew University men's soccer team opened its 2022 season on fire, scoring three goals in the first half en route to a 4-0 victory at cross-town rival FDU-Florham in non-conference action Thursday evening.
Balanced scoring did the trick for the Rangers, who received four goals from four different players.
Junior
Christian Tyson gave the Blue and Green their first goal of the season, converting a feed from classmate
Matthew Agudelo. Exactly three minutes later, the two switched roles when Agudelo finished off a pass from Tyson. Then in the 39th minute, sophomore
Thomas Zurkowski completed the big half, chipping in a shot high into the net off a cross from freshman
Gabe Di Pierro.
Junior
Michael Steinberg set the final score in the 89th minute, scoring his first collegiate goal.
Drew outshot the Devils 16-9 and senior
Calum Erlenborn saved both FDU shots on goal en route to his third career shutout.
The Rangers continue their four-day, three-game stretch to open the season when they play New Paltz in their home opener on Saturday at 5 p.m. in the Drew/FDU Fall Festival.
